Cazenove Capital Eventing Grand Prix Provides Exciting Spectacle at Bolesworth International Horse Show

New for 2018 at The Equerry Bolesworth International Horse Show is the exciting Cazenove Capital Eventing Grand Prix. 
This fast and furious competition will provide a high calibre invitational spectacle as both elite show jumpers and event riders tackle a course of show jumps and feature cross-country fences in a relay format.

Starting in the International Arena as the feature class on the evening of Thursday, June 14, the Eventing Grand Prix will see eventers and showjumpers pair up, to then compete against the clock, racing over approximately 30 jumps and cross-country style obstacles.
Each pair will take on a combination of fences, including a brand new set of cross- country fences incorporating the Bolesworth International arena’s iconic moat. The Cazenove Capital prize will go to the pair with the fastest combined time and the least faults. Each knocked down fence will incur seconds added on to the rider’s time with the lucky winner taking home the £1,000 first prize.
Said Show President, Nina Barbour: “We are delighted to be able to build on our existing relationship with Cazenove Capital by involving them in this new and innovative class. We will be seeing some of the leading riders from both sports at their best in this exciting feature class.”
Also on Thursday in the International Arena classes will include the FEI Pony Team Dressage Test, CDI*** Grand Prix Special, Grand Prix Freestyle to Music, Carl Hester Masterclass, CSI 4* Showjumping. The evening will come to a close with the highly anticipated Bolesworth Elite Sport Horse Auction, after the hammer fell at £92,000 for last year’s record breaking top lot.
